Klasse ZSearchService
java.lang.Object
org.xbib.interlibrary.action.search.AbstractSearchService<org.xbib.interlibrary.action.search.SearchRequest,org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>,org.xbib.interlibrary.action.search.SearchService>
org.xbib.interlibrary.z.AbstractZSearchService
org.xbib.interlibrary.client.bvb.z.ZSearchService
- Alle implementierten Schnittstellen:
Comparable<org.xbib.interlibrary.api.action.Service<org.xbib.interlibrary.action.search.SearchRequest,
,org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>, org.xbib.interlibrary.action.search.SearchResponseBuilder>> org.xbib.interlibrary.action.search.SearchService
,org.xbib.interlibrary.api.action.Service<org.xbib.interlibrary.action.search.SearchRequest,
org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>, org.xbib.interlibrary.action.search.SearchResponseBuilder>
public class ZSearchService
extends org.xbib.interlibrary.z.AbstractZSearchService
-
Feldübersicht
Von Klasse geerbte Felder org.xbib.interlibrary.z.AbstractZSearchService
marcHelper
Von Klasse geerbte Felder org.xbib.interlibrary.action.search.AbstractSearchService
arguments
-
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ungZSearchService
(org.xbib.interlibrary.api.action.ServiceArguments arguments) -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ungint
compareTo
(org.xbib.interlibrary.api.action.Service<org.xbib.interlibrary.action.search.SearchRequest, org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>, org.xbib.interlibrary.action.search.SearchResponseBuilder> o) protected boolean
fixByOne()
protected void
search
(org.xbib.interlibrary.action.search.SearchRequest request, org.xbib.interlibrary.action.search.SearchResponseBuilder response, int recordNumber, org.xbib.marc.MarcRecord marcRecord) Von Klasse geerbte Methoden org.xbib.interlibrary.z.AbstractZSearchService
buildCQLQueryTerm, buildPQFQueryTerm, close, encodeCQL, encodePQF, encodeQueryString, encodeQueryStringToAscii, encodeSort, evaluateSyntax, execute, getEscapedString, getRelation, isSingleWord, matchesPunctuation, normalizeValue, quote, supports, trim
Von Klasse geerbte Methoden org.xbib.interlibrary.action.search.AbstractSearchService
addThrowable, getLabel, getLastThrowable, getName, getSettings, getSortKey, getURL, isEnabled, logSource, setEnabled
-
Konstruktordetails
-
ZSearchService
public ZSearchService(org.xbib.interlibrary.api.action.ServiceArguments arguments)
-
-
Methodendetails
-
fixByOne
protected boolean fixByOne()- Angegeben von:
fixByOne
in Klasseorg.xbib.interlibrary.action.search.AbstractSearchService<org.xbib.interlibrary.action.search.SearchRequest,
org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>, org.xbib.interlibrary.action.search.SearchService>
-
search
protected void search(org.xbib.interlibrary.action.search.SearchRequest request, org.xbib.interlibrary.action.search.SearchResponseBuilder response, int recordNumber, org.xbib.marc.MarcRecord marcRecord) - Angegeben von:
search
in Klasseorg.xbib.interlibrary.z.AbstractZSearchService
-
compareTo
public int compareTo(org.xbib.interlibrary.api.action.Service<org.xbib.interlibrary.action.search.SearchRequest, org.xbib.interlibrary.action.search.SearchResponse<org.xbib.interlibrary.action.search.SearchRequest>, org.xbib.interlibrary.action.search.SearchResponseBuilder> o)
-